Khulna Printing and Packaging Limited, which is listed on the stock exchange, has incurred huge losses.
The company’s net asset value has also turned negative. So, the investors in this company are in extreme uncertainty.
The company has posted a 9,700-percent increase in its losses in the second quarter ended on December 31, 2021 as against the same quarter last year.
Its losses per share stood at Tk 1.96 in the Q2, up from Tk 0.02 recorded in the same period a year earlier, said the company in a filing with the Dhaka Stock Exchange on Thursday.
As of December 31, 2021, the company’s net asset value (NAV) per share stood at (negative) Tk 1.76.
Meanwhile, the company had consolidated losses per share of Tk 2.99 in the first six months of the current financial year (July-December).
The losses for the same period of the previous financial year were Tk 0.10. As a result, the company’s losses increased by Tk 2.89 or 2,890 percent.
